【问题标题】:How to import okhttp library to android studio?如何将 okhttp 库导入到 android studio?
【发布时间】:2015-02-10 15:44:57
【问题描述】:

我想将 okhttp 源代码(不是 jar)作为模块导入到 android studio。对此有什么建议吗?谢谢 !

【问题讨论】:

    标签: android android-studio okhttp


    【解决方案1】:

    除非您出于某种原因在您的应用中只需要源代码,否则您可以通过添加将其添加为库

    implementation 'com.squareup.okhttp3:okhttp:3.10.0'
    

    到您的 Gradle 构建脚本

    【讨论】:

    • 现在compile 'com.squareup.okhttp:okhttp:2.4.0'
    • 2016 年 12 月。最新版本的行可以在 github.com/square/okhttp/blob/master/README.md 找到。目前的线路是compile 'com.squareup.okhttp3:okhttp:3.5.0'
    • 我收到:Error:(3, 0) Could not find method compile() for arguments [com.squareup.okhttp3:okhttp:3.5.0] on project ':app' of type org.gradle.api.Project.
    【解决方案2】:

    将此行添加到您的模块级别 build.gradle 脚本(不是项目级别):

    dependencies {
        // ...
        implementation 'com.squareup.okhttp3:okhttp:3.10.0'
    }
    

    然后单击右上角的构建图标(绿色斧头)。

    【讨论】:

      【解决方案3】:

      他们的源代码在 Github 上:https://github.com/square/okhttp

      将其克隆到您的机器上,然后将其导入您的项目中。

      【讨论】:

        【解决方案4】:

        OkHttp是一个java项目,可以使用idea而不是Android studio。

        1. 打开思路
        2. 项目→打开→选择项目根目录pop.xml
        3. 等一下

        【讨论】:

          猜你喜欢
          • 1970-01-01
          • 1970-01-01
          • 1970-01-01
          • 1970-01-01
          • 2014-02-24
          • 2015-06-13
          • 2013-09-15
          • 1970-01-01
          • 2015-06-28
          相关资源
          最近更新 更多